WebJesus’ First Miracle. IT HAS been only a day or two since Andrew, Peter, John, Philip, Nathanael, and perhaps James became Jesus’ first disciples. These now are on their way home to the district of Galilee, where all of them originated. Their destination is Cana, the hometown of Nathanael, located in the hills not far from Nazareth, where ... WebThe miracle of Jesus turning water into wine at the wedding at Cana is the first of Jesus’ miracles recounted in the Gospel of John, and as such it marks a decisive moment in the story of Jesus’ divinity. But there are several mysterious details about the story which are worthy of closer analysis, not least the matter of where ‘Cana’ exactly was.

The transformation of water into wine at the wedding at Cana (also called the marriage at Cana, wedding feast at Cana or marriage feast at Cana) is the first miracle attributed to Jesus in the Gospel of John. Web9 giu 2010 · The description of the miracle at Cana may be John's symbolic way to tell about the nativity, Huntsman wrote. If it is, then this first miracle or sign of Jesus' ministry points directly to the first miracle and sign of Christ's condescension: "The Word was made flesh, and dwelt among us" (John 1:14).
